In my opinion, the United States' withdrawal from the Paris Climate Agreement will lead to higher globalized ecological footprint.
While the United States is not the no.1 polluter in the world (that distinction goes to China), the US is still a large country with hundreds of millions of people who might use more energy, fuel, coal and other fossilized fuels.
After signing the Paris Climate Agreement, the United States had set milestones to meet and reduce dependence on fossil fuels, but after it's withdrawal, the government is not bound by any such restrictions.
